Course Description
This unit describes the skills and knowledge required to assess structural components and services in a residential building to determine their impact on the interior design brief.
This unit applies to interior designers, including kitchen and bathroom designers. They analyse and integrate information from site inspection, documentation and consultation to inform the design process.
Licensing, legislative or certification requirements may apply to this unit and relevant state/territory and local government agencies should be consulted to determine any necessary certification or licensing for undertaking interior decoration and design work. Access to construction sites requires certification of general induction training specified by the National Code of Practice for Induction for Construction Work (ASCC 2007).
National Codes, Titles, Elements and Performance Criteria
National Element Code & Title: |
MSFID5021 Evaluate site structure and services for interior design briefs |
Element: |
1. Prepare for site evaluation |
Performance Criteria: |
1.1 Review project brief and clarify with client 1.2 Confirm and evaluate parameters and constraints 1.3 Select work resources based on the needs of the design brief 1.4 Determine scope of site evaluation from information and arrange a site visit with client 1.5 Identify and follow work health and safety requirements for specific site |
Element: |
2. Assess structural elements |
Performance Criteria: |
2.1 Identify and inspect key structural elements of the space for their impact on the design brief 2.2 Identify changes required to structural elements to meet design brief and examine implications 2.3 Assess materials and finishes used in structural aspects for their implications for the design brief 2.4 Identify the need for specialist assessment of structural implications, communicate to the client and organise within the scope of the design brief 2.5 Measure space accurately and document results to inform design project and documentation |
Element: |
3. Assess services |
Performance Criteria: |
3.1 Identify and assess plumbing, water and drainage features for impact on design brief 3.2 Assess features of electrical service to determine suitability for design requirements 3.3 Assess other services to determine suitability for design requirements |
Element: |
4. Conduct additional research to support site evaluation |
Performance Criteria: |
4.1 Confirm outcomes of site evaluation through consultation with specialist professionals based on the design brief 4.2 Accurately interpret building documentation for additional information 4.3 Review information gathered against compliance requirements and identify further work needs 4.4 Accurately document site evaluation information and research outcomes |
